All pastors received a notice from Bishop Michael McKee early this afternoon which said: “All persons 60 years and older, as well as those with underlying health conditions or any cough or illness, should stay away from church for the next two Sundays (March 15 & 22). I encourage any church to share an online message.”

We at Wesley encourage you to follow suggestions and protocol to protect yourself and others from the Coronavirus (COVID 19). Wash your hands often, singing the Happy Birthday song, This is the Day the Lord Has Made or even saying The Lord’s Prayer. Use tissues for coughs and sneezes and toss in the trash can immediately. Use hand sanitizer that is at least 60% alcohol. In public, keep six feet away from other people. These are the Center for Disease Control protocols.

This Sunday, and until further notice, we will only have Worship Service in Wesley Hall at 9:30 a.m. We will close down our sanctuary and have no Sunday School for the next three Sundays (Mar. 15, 22, & 29). The service will be presented on Facebook and our website. In addition, we will not have Wednesday evening activities or group activities for the rest of March.

Breaking Bread has been suspended until we receive an ALL CLEAR from the health authorities as well as Bishop McKee.

We do encourage you to connect with one another by phone and/or social media. Texting, email or Face Time are all options for staying in touch. In these uncertain times, Social Media could be the biggest blessing we have in order to connect with others while staying in and away from COVID 19.

Let’s continue to care for and pray for each other. With God’s help and us doing our part, we will get through this. “Cast your cares on Christ for He care about you.” I Peter 5:7
